Description & Qualifications

Description As a Manager, you will lead India-based security personnel, including the Security Operations Center team that uses a follow-the-sun structure. You will work to ensure continuous monitoring, detection and response to security events affecting UKG and customers, as well as working closely with our security operations teams in Singapore and Fort Lauderdale. You will manage the India team and take ownership of our customers\' escalations during the India business hours.

Together with the SOC team, you will monitor for infiltration attempts, analyze logs looking for
patterns to ensure that infiltration attempts are identified and dealt with in a timely manner.
You will identify attack patterns, figure out how to defend against them, and continuously evolve the team to be more efficient through the creation of tools and/or enhancements to our detection systems. You will be working closely with our threat intelligence and counter security teams to ensure that we are always one step ahead of the adversaries.

You will be there to support the team whenever they need your assistance, guidance and
advice. You must enjoy doing hands-on technical work, and will represent the final level of escalation, as needed. You must always look to improve the SOC and critique the status quo, constantly striving to work to improve the global team.

Due to the nature of the work, you are required to have occasional on-call duties on weekends and/or holidays. Additional work hours may also be required during an incident investigation.
